Barber Half Dollar - Liberty Head with laurel wreath and cap (Charles Barber design)

Barber Half Dollar coins were minted from 1892-1915, designed by Charles E. Barber. This series includes 7 coins in our database. Values range from $53 to $103,375. The most sought-after is the 1897-S Barber Half Dollar.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is the most valuable Barber Half Dollar? +
The 1897-S Barber Half Dollar is among the most valuable in this series. It is considered a key date by collectors. Condition plays a major role in value, so we recommend scanning your coin for a personalized estimate.
